The administrative center is the village of Borisovo .
The parish was formed during the reform of 1861 ; she united 5 settlements.
In the 1880s , the volost was abolished, and its territory entered the Chemlyzh volost .
Today, the entire territory of the former Borisov Volost is included in the Sevsky District of the Bryansk Region .
